HP ENVY x360 13-ag0042AU
Ubuntu LTS

Hello.

I have a big problem with my HP laptop.

CPU fan always running at max speed even in BIOS. Windows 10 with power saving settings, Linux Mint with power saving setting - doesn't matter - result always the same.

Inside laptop have no dust at all, the blowing air is cold. 'Fan always on' option in BIOS is disabled.

Tried to reset BIOS to default settings - no result.

Change to 'Enable' 'Fan always on' option, rebooting and change it back to 'Disable' - no effect.

BIOS version is up to date F.47.
